What’s the Difference Between SSL/TLS/HTTPS SSL stands for Secure Sockets … Witryna15 maj 2024 · Continued use of the plaintext REDIS_URL will function as expected, even after upgrading from version 4 or 5 to version 6. However, we recommend using the encrypted REDIS_TLS_URL for all client connections.. In the future, the plaintext redis:// connection string will be replaced with the encrypted rediss:// connection string. It is …

Witryna26 lut 2013 · On Heroku, request.header ('x-forwarded-proto') will contain the actual protocol string (eg, 'http' or 'https'). Express Middleware SSL Redirect If you're using the Express framework on Node, then you have it easy. There's already a great middleware mechanism for you to send any or all requests through.
